//---------------------------------------------------------------------------
// Key codes as defined by USB spec 1.11
//---------------------------------------------------------------------------
#pragma once
#include <stdint.h>
//---------------------------------------------------------------------------
// pico-sdk defines F# macros, that interfere with the KeyCodes
#undef F1
#undef F2
#undef F3
#undef F4
#undef F5
#undef F6
#undef F7
#undef F8
#undef F9
#undef F10
#undef F11
#undef F12
#undef F13
#undef F14
#undef F15
//---------------------------------------------------------------------------
struct KeyCode {
enum Value : uint8_t {
A = 0x04,
B = 0x05,
C = 0x06,
D = 0x07,
E = 0x08,
F = 0x09,
G = 0x0a,
H = 0x0b,
I = 0x0c,
J = 0x0d,
K = 0x0e,
L = 0x0f,
M = 0x10,
N = 0x11,
O = 0x12,
P = 0x13,
Q = 0x14,
R = 0x15,
S = 0x16,
T = 0x17,
U = 0x18,
V = 0x19,
W = 0x1a,
X = 0x1b,
Y = 0x1c,
Z = 0x1d,
_1 = 0x1e,
_2 = 0x1f,
_3 = 0x20,
_4 = 0x21,
_5 = 0x22,
_6 = 0x23,
_7 = 0x24,
_8 = 0x25,
_9 = 0x26,
_0 = 0x27,
ENTER = 0x28,
ESC = 0x29,
BACKSPACE = 0x2a,
TAB = 0x2b,
SPACE = 0x2c,
MINUS = 0x2d,
EQUAL = 0x2e,
L_BRACKET = 0x2f,
R_BRACKET = 0x30,
BACKSLASH = 0x31,
HASH_TILDE = 0x32,
SEMICOLON = 0x33,
APOSTROPHE = 0x34,
GRAVE = 0x35,
COMMA = 0x36,
DOT = 0x37,
SLASH = 0x38,
CAPS_LOCK = 0x39,
F1 = 0x3a,
F2 = 0x3b,
F3 = 0x3c,
F4 = 0x3d,
F5 = 0x3e,
F6 = 0x3f,
F7 = 0x40,
F8 = 0x41,
F9 = 0x42,
F10 = 0x43,
F11 = 0x44,
F12 = 0x45,
PRINT_SCREEN = 0x46,
SCROLL_LOCK = 0x47,
PAUSE = 0x48,
INSERT = 0x49,
HOME = 0x4a,
PAGE_UP = 0x4b,
DELETE = 0x4c,
END = 0x4d,
PAGE_DOWN = 0x4e,
RIGHT = 0x4f,
LEFT = 0x50,
DOWN = 0x51,
UP = 0x52,
NUM_LOCK = 0x53,
KP_SLASH = 0x54,
KP_ASTERISK = 0x55,
KP_MINUS = 0x56,
KP_PLUS = 0x57,
KP_ENTER = 0x58,
KP_1 = 0x59,
KP_2 = 0x5a,
KP_3 = 0x5b,
KP_4 = 0x5c,
KP_5 = 0x5d,
KP_6 = 0x5e,
KP_7 = 0x5f,
KP_8 = 0x60,
KP_9 = 0x61,
KP_0 = 0x62,
KP_DOT = 0x63,
BACKSLASH_PIPE = 0x64,
COMPOSE = 0x65,
POWER = 0x66,
KP_EQUAL = 0x67,
F13 = 0x68,
F14 = 0x69,
F15 = 0x6a,
F16 = 0x6b,
F17 = 0x6c,
F18 = 0x6d,
F19 = 0x6e,
F20 = 0x6f,
F21 = 0x70,
F22 = 0x71,
F23 = 0x72,
F24 = 0x73,
OPEN = 0x74,
HELP = 0x75,
MENU = 0x76,
SELECT = 0x77,
STOP = 0x78,
AGAIN = 0x79,
UNDO = 0x7a,
CUT = 0x7b,
COPY = 0x7c,
PASTE = 0x7d,
FIND = 0x7e,
MUTE = 0x7f,
VOLUME_UP = 0x80,
VOLUME_DOWN = 0x81,
KP_COMMA = 0x85,
RO = 0x87,
KANA = 0x88,
YEN = 0x89,
HENKAN = 0x8a,
MUHENKAN = 0x8b,
KP_JP_COMMA = 0x8c,
HANGEUL = 0x90,
HANJA = 0x91,
KATAKANA = 0x92,
HIRAGANA = 0x93,
HANKAKU_ZENKAKU = 0x94,
FURIGANA = 0x95,
CLEAR = 0x9c,
L_CTRL = 0xe0,
L_SHIFT = 0xe1,
L_ALT = 0xe2,
L_META = 0xe3,
R_CTRL = 0xe4,
R_SHIFT = 0xe5,
R_ALT = 0xe6,
R_META = 0xe7,
// From Consumer Page (0x0c)
CONSUMER_PAGE_PLAY = 0xa0, // UsageId 0xb0
CONSUMER_PAGE_PAUSE = 0xa1, // UsageId 0xb1
CONSUMER_PAGE_RECORD = 0xa2, // UsageId 0xb2
CONSUMER_PAGE_FAST_FORWARD = 0xa3, // UsageId 0xb3
CONSUMER_PAGE_REWIND = 0xa4, // UsageId 0xb4
CONSUMER_PAGE_SCAN_NEXT_TRACK = 0xa5, // UsageId 0xb5
CONSUMER_PAGE_SCAN_PREVIOUS_TRACK = 0xa6, // UsageId 0xb6
CONSUMER_PAGE_STOP = 0xa7, // UsageId 0xb7
CONSUMER_PAGE_EJECT = 0xa8, // UsageId 0xb8
CONSUMER_PAGE_STOP_EJECT = 0xbc, // UsageId 0xcc
CONSUMER_PAGE_PLAY_PAUSE = 0xbd, // UsageId 0xcd
CONSUMER_PAGE_PLAY_SKIP = 0xbe, // UsageId 0xce
CONSUMER_PAGE_MUTE = 0xd2, // UsageId 0xe2
CONSUMER_PAGE_VOLUME_UP = 0xd9, // UsageId 0xe9
CONSUMER_PAGE_VOLUME_DOWN = 0xda, // UsageId 0xea
};
KeyCode() = default;
constexpr KeyCode(uint32_t value) : value(value) {}
bool IsVisible() const {
return (A <= value && value <= ENTER) || (TAB <= value && value <= SLASH) ||
(KP_SLASH <= value && value <= BACKSLASH_PIPE);
}
bool IsModifier() const { return L_CTRL <= value && value <= R_META; }
// keyCode is in the lower 8 bits.
// modifiers are in the next 8 bits and uses the values defined in
// steno_key_code.h.
//
// Returns 0 if there's no simple conversion.
static uint32_t ConvertToUnicode(uint32_t keyCodeAndModifiers);
bool operator==(const KeyCode &other) const { return value == other.value; }
bool operator!=(const KeyCode &other) const { return value != other.value; }
uint32_t value;
};
//---------------------------------------------------------------------------
